Output 6e12ea86572be25de2bd68f5c76d8625bad8564b56a9d8b4c619f9f6adf81784:2

value
67499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ff129fca3e73a17a6bac731e7d0078e35d7b6806 OP_EQUAL
address
3QwiYVSfm2UsBR1S9wucUZBBMumHqCHhBw
transaction
6e12ea86572be25de2bd68f5c76d8625bad8564b56a9d8b4c619f9f6adf81784
confirmations
257955
spent
true